A Fifth Of Alcohol Is How Many Liters Source: bing.com

A fifth of alcohol is a common measure of liquor, especially in the United States. A fifth is equal to 25.6 fluid ounces or 750 milliliters. In terms of liters, a fifth of alcohol is 0.75 liters. This is a standard measure of liquor, and it is often used in recipes that call for a certain amount of liquor.
